It's currently hard to review ipnetns. The netns ids are inconsistently
treated as signed or unsigned and most helper functions aren't prepared
to use negative ids.

Netns id attributes can be negative: NETNSA_NSID_NOT_ASSIGNED == -1.
So let's consistently treat nsids as signed and also reject negative
values in functions that are supposed to only handle assigned netns
ids.

While there, let's drop the extra blank line generated by some command
line parsing errors (patch 5/5).

* [PATCH iproute2-next 1/5] ipnetns: treat NETNSA_NSID and NETNSA_CURRENT_NSID as signed

These attributes are signed (with -1 meaning NETNSA_NSID_NOT_ASSIGNED).
So let's use rta_getattr_s32() and print_int() instead of their
unsigned counterpart to avoid confusion.

* [PATCH iproute2-next 3/5] ipnetns: harden helper functions wrt. negative netns ids

Negative values are invalid netns ids. Ensure that helper functions
don't accidentally try to process them.

diff --git a/ip/ipnetns.c b/ip/ipnetns.c
index b02e0a8a..77531d6c 100644
--- a/ip/ipnetns.c
+++ b/ip/ipnetns.c
@@ -161,9 +161,13 @@ static struct hlist_head	name_head[NSIDMAP_SIZE];
 
 static struct nsid_cache *netns_map_get_by_nsid(int nsid)
 {
-	uint32_t h = NSID_HASH_NSID(nsid);
 	struct hlist_node *n;
+	uint32_t h;
+
+	if (nsid < 0)
+		return NULL;
 
+	h = NSID_HASH_NSID(nsid);
 	hlist_for_each(n, &nsid_head[h]) {
 		struct nsid_cache *c = container_of(n, struct nsid_cache,
 						    nsid_hash);
@@ -178,6 +182,9 @@ char *get_name_from_nsid(int nsid)
 {
 	struct nsid_cache *c;
 
+	if (nsid < 0)
+		return NULL;
+
 	netns_nsid_socket_init();
 	netns_map_init();
 
@@ -266,6 +273,9 @@ static int netns_get_name(int nsid, char *name)
 	DIR *dir;
 	int id;
 
+	if (nsid < 0)
+		return -EINVAL;
+
 	dir = opendir(NETNS_RUN_DIR);
 	if (!dir)
 		return -ENOENT;
@@ -277,7 +287,7 @@ static int netns_get_name(int nsid, char *name)
 			continue;
 		id = get_netnsid_from_name(entry->d_name);
 
-		if (nsid == id) {
+		if (id >= 0 && nsid == id) {
 			strcpy(name, entry->d_name);
 			closedir(dir);
 			return 0;

* [PATCH iproute2-next 4/5] ipnetns: don't print unassigned nsid in json export

Don't output the nsid and current-nsid json keys if they're not set.
Otherwise a parser would have to special case the "not-assigned"
string.

* [PATCH iproute2-next 5/5] ipnetns: remove blank lines printed by invarg() messages

Since invarg() automatically adds a '\n' character, having one in the
error message generates an extra blank line.
